EU’s response to the repeated killing of humanitarian aid workers, journalists and civilians by the Israel Defence Forces in the Gaza Strip (debate)
Madam President! The world has not in my time seen a worse attack than Israel's on Gaza with hunger, thirst and medicine as weapons, on top of the continuous bombardment and shootings. 34 000 are reported killed, half of them children. No horror surpasses this. With the killing of aid workers, we lose arms and legs in the disaster area, but our eyes are also blinded. The fact that Israel is denying journalists access to Gaza means that we only have those who were there before. And here grotesquely many, probably hundreds have been killed. Soon we will have Hamas alone as a news source. Israel must be pressured to allow journalists in immediately. We all need their eyes to see what is really happening, and the EU must immediately include Gaza and the West Bank’s journalists in the EU’s Media Freedom Rapid Response, as well as Ukraine’s journalists. It is also urgent to have an independent investigation into the many killings of journalists and the responsible Israelis on the EU sanctions list. Impunity is a plague in the Israeli-Palestinian conflict.
